PRIVACY-FOCUSED REDACTABLE BLOCKCHAIN WITH RESTRICTED ACCESS IN DECENTRALIZED ECOSYSTEMS

Redactable blockchain, which provides decentralization, traceability, and transparency while permitting permitted changes to on-chain data, has become a promising technology in recent years. Despite their benefits, existing redactable blockchain systems are limited in their practical use by issues including significant communication overhead and data privacy breaches. This study presents PriChain, a fine-grained redactable blockchain technology for decentralized contexts that preserves privacy in order to address these problems. PriChain gives data owners the authority to manage who may access and alter their on-chain data, guaranteeing that redaction can only be carried out by authorized users while maintaining data confidentiality. Through the use of attributebased encryption with several authorities, PriChain guarantees resistance to unwanted cooperation or collusion and permits exact access control. When compared to traditional techniques, the framework dramatically lowers communication and storage overhead. PriChain is a reliable and useful option for blockchain applications that prioritize privacy as security analysis demonstrates that it is impervious to chosen-plaintext attacks.

HIGH-PRECISION AERIAL OBJECT DETECTION MODEL UTILIZING YOLO V10 DEEP NEURAL NETWORK

The installation of a real-time visual tracking system with an active pan-tilt camera for indoor human motion detection is presented in this study. For precise and effective human detection in every video frame, the system makes use of the cutting-edge YOLOv10 object detection model. YOLOv10 is perfect for real-time applications due to its fast inference and enhanced detection accuracy, especially in difficult illumination and occlusion situations. The system uses a multiple object tracking (MOT) framework that keeps a dynamic graph structure to guarantee robustness. Several theories about the quantity and temporal trajectories of identified persons are handled by this graph. YOLOv10 allows frame-wise object detection with fewer false positives and missing detections than traditional frame differencing techniques. In order to achieve consistent tracking throughout time, the MOT module performs temporal data association, checking and confirming YOLOv10's frame-wise predictions. Because of this close interaction, the tracker can estimate object placements and increase overall tracking reliability by giving feedback to the detection module. In order to choose the most plausible explanation for the observed video, tracking hypotheses are continuously expanded and trimmed. The system's efficacy in real-time human motion tracking scenarios is demonstrated by experimental results, which show that the inclusion of YOLOv10 significantly improves detection precision and temporal consistency.
